

The qualification, above all else, will be relevant to the modern and changing world of technology. There will be a focus on programming and an emphasise on the importance of computational thinking as a discipline. With computational thinking at its core, the course will help students to develop the skills to solve problems, design systems and understand machine intelligence. The course will also enable students the opportunity to apply the academic principles learned in the classroom to real world systems in an exciting and engaging manner.
A 6 in GCSE Computer Science OR a 6 in GCSE Maths is required if you are not currently studying GCSE Computer Science. In addition, a Grade 5 in Mathematics and a 5 in English Language is required as part of the A Level Plus Programme
